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
28 750 62855845365 8714532 59308
97664444721 1703621
97664444721 1703621
797359908 39 526967987 89851
All about undefined
Interested in learning more?
97664444721 1703621
797359908 39 526967987 89851
See more
09 53
523 077180 897116
See more
663825155 40570312
028082474 8604 507389 98112238060
See more